How Human Rights Laws and Economic Competitiveness Can Co-Exist
Episode 26
Tuesday, 9 September, 2025
In an analysis of French companies in response to the French Duty of Vigilance Law, Dr. Bernhard Reinsberg and Dr. Christoph Valentin Steinert assess whether compliance with mandatory due diligence laws impacts businesses' profitability. Their findings of their article 'The French duty of vigilance law: reconciling human rights and firm profitability’ published in the Review of International Political Economychallenge widespread industry claims that such regulations threaten competitiveness and provide crucial evidence for policymakers considering similar legislation worldwide.
